The Importance of Purity in Creatine

Creatine is one of the most widely researched and effective sports supplements available, with decades of scientific backing for its ability to increase strength, power, and muscle mass. However, not all creatine is created equal. The quality and purity of a creatine supplement can vary dramatically depending on its source and manufacturing process. Poorly manufactured creatine may contain unwanted impurities and byproducts, which can compromise its effectiveness and potentially cause negative side effects. High quality creatine, by contrast, undergoes stringent testing to ensure a product that is nearly 100% pure, delivering optimal results with fewer risks.

What Differentiates High-Quality from Low-Quality Creatine?

  • Manufacturing standards: High-quality creatine is produced in facilities that adhere to strict Good Manufacturing Practices (GMP) and other recognized quality protocols. Low-quality products often come from manufacturers with lax or unknown standards.
  • Impurities and byproducts: A key difference lies in the presence of impurities. Low-quality creatine may contain contaminants like creatinine, dicyandiamide, and heavy metals. High-quality, pharmaceutical-grade creatine, like Creapure®, systematically tests for and minimizes these unwanted substances.
  • Consistency: Purity testing on high-quality brands ensures a consistent, effective product in every batch. The quality of generic creatines can fluctuate, leading to inconsistent results.

The Gold Standard: Creapure® Creatine Monohydrate

For many, the name Creapure® is synonymous with high quality creatine. Produced in Germany by AlzChem Trostberg GmbH, Creapure® is a patented form of creatine monohydrate known for its unmatched purity of 99.99%. It is manufactured in a dedicated facility with robust quality control, including regular internal and external audits to guarantee the absence of contaminants and banned substances. While it comes at a higher cost than generic versions, many athletes consider it a worthwhile investment for the peace of mind that comes with superior traceability and purity.

Micronization and its Benefits

Beyond raw purity, the physical form of the creatine powder can impact its user experience. Micronized creatine is a specific processing of creatine monohydrate that reduces the particle size.

Benefits of micronized creatine include:

  • Improved solubility: The smaller particles dissolve more easily and completely in liquids, preventing a gritty texture.
  • Reduced gastrointestinal discomfort: Poorly dissolved creatine can sit in the stomach and cause bloating or upset. The enhanced solubility of micronized versions reduces this risk.
  • Enhanced absorption: While standard creatine monohydrate is well-absorbed, the finer particles of micronized creatine may offer slightly faster and more efficient absorption for some individuals.

Beware of Generic and Unproven Forms

As creatine's popularity has grown, so have the number of different types available. However, most of these alternatives, including creatine HCl, ethyl ester, and others, lack the extensive scientific research and proven effectiveness of creatine monohydrate. The additional processing required often increases the price without offering any scientifically proven performance advantages. Furthermore, some lesser-known brands may use cheap, impure raw materials to produce these alternatives, increasing the risk of contamination. STICKING to a pure creatine monohydrate is the most reliable strategy.

Key Factors for Identifying High Quality Creatine

Third-Party Testing and Certifications

Since the supplement industry lacks strict FDA oversight in many regions, relying on third-party verification is crucial. Look for certifications from independent organizations like NSF Certified for Sport®, Informed-Sport, or U.S. Pharmacopeia (USP). These certifications indicate that a product has been tested for banned substances, contaminants, and that the contents match the label claims. This is especially important for competitive athletes who are subject to drug testing.

Manufacturing Standards (GMP)

Good Manufacturing Practices (GMP) are a set of guidelines ensuring products are consistently produced and controlled according to quality standards. Choosing a brand that publicly states its GMP compliance signals a commitment to quality and safety.

The Potential Dangers of Impure Creatine

The rush to market during periods of high demand has sometimes led to lower-quality, impure creatine products making their way to consumers. These inferior products pose several risks. The most concerning impurity, dicyandiamide, can break down into the toxic hydrogen cyanide in the acidic stomach environment. While the immediate effects may not be lethal, chronic ingestion of small amounts could lead to symptoms like headaches, nausea, and in extreme cases, more severe health issues. Impure creatine can also contain other manufacturing byproducts and heavy metals that pose health risks. This highlights why purchasing from reputable, transparent brands that prioritize quality testing is a non-negotiable step for supplement users.

How to Choose the Right Creatine for You

Making an informed decision about creatine requires a simple, yet effective, process:

  1. Prioritize Purity: Start with brands known for using high-quality raw materials, such as those with the Creapure® label.
  2. Verify with Third-Party Testing: Look for logos from reputable certification bodies on the packaging or website. This confirms independent lab verification of purity and content.
  3. Opt for Monohydrate: Choose the most researched form of creatine—creatine monohydrate—unless you have a specific, documented reason to try an alternative.
  4. Consider Micronized: If you experience digestive issues or simply prefer a smoother-mixing drink, micronized creatine monohydrate is a wise choice.
  5. Be Wary of Low Prices: A price that seems too good to be true is often an indicator of improper purification or low-grade materials.
